MRK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2020 in Review

2,709 of the 5,652 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Merck (MRK) for Q4 2020, worth a combined $155B — down 0.78% from $156B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 302 funds opened new MRK positions and 114 closed out — a net gain of 188 holders — while 1,216 added to existing stakes and 901 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Berkshire Hathaway, adding an estimated $505M. The largest seller was Capital World Investors, cutting an estimated $444M.
